BSE Ltd experienced a mixed week from 15 to 19 June 2026, closing marginally lower by 0.52% at Rs.4,020.20, while the Sensex advanced 2.35%. Despite the slight decline, the stock demonstrated robust institutional interest and strong trading volumes, supported by an upgraded Mojo Grade of Strong Buy and sustained technical strength above key moving averages. This review analyses the key events shaping the stock’s performance and the implications for investors.

15 June: Strong Institutional Interest Drives 3.43% Price Surge

BSE Ltd kicked off the week with a robust trading session on 15 June 2026, recording a total traded volume of 20,49,607 shares and a traded value of ₹84,495.25 lakhs. The stock opened at Rs.4,149.90, surged to an intraday high of Rs.4,192.30, and closed at Rs.4,188.40, marking a significant 3.43% gain over the previous close of Rs.4,041.10. This outperformance was well above the Sensex’s 1.19% rise and the capital markets sector’s 3.05% gain, highlighting strong investor confidence and institutional participation. The stock traded above all key moving averages, signalling a sustained bullish trend.

16 June: Mixed Market Sentiment Leads to Modest Price Decline

On 16 June, BSE Ltd saw a decline of 0.88% to close at Rs.4,162.40, despite maintaining strong trading volumes of 5,38,466 shares and a traded value of ₹221.63 crores. The stock underperformed the Sensex, which gained 0.49%, and the capital markets sector’s 0.81% rise. Delivery volumes surged by 75.25% compared to the five-day average, indicating increased long-term investor accumulation. The stock remained above all major moving averages, suggesting underlying technical strength despite short-term profit-taking pressures.

17 June: Technical Momentum Upgrade Amidst Robust Value Trading

BSE Ltd’s technical momentum shifted positively on 17 June, with the stock gaining 0.38% to Rs.4,014.50. The total traded volume was 9,33,972 shares, with a traded value of ₹39,139.22 lakhs. The stock outperformed its sector by 0.28% and held steady against the Sensex’s 0.29% gain. Despite a 27.84% decline in delivery volumes versus the five-day average, the stock’s price remained above all key moving averages, reinforcing a bullish technical setup. The Mojo Grade upgrade to Strong Buy with a score of 90.0 further reflected growing institutional confidence and improved fundamentals.

18 June: Delivery Volumes Surge Amid Price Consolidation

On 18 June, BSE Ltd’s price consolidated near Rs.4,000, closing marginally down 0.01% at Rs.3,999.20. The stock recorded a total traded volume of 9,42,565 shares and a traded value of ₹37,686.01 lakhs. Delivery volumes surged dramatically by 144.79% compared to the five-day average, reaching 22.72 lakh shares, signalling strong institutional accumulation and long-term investor conviction. The stock traded above its 50-day, 100-day, and 200-day moving averages but dipped below the short-term 5-day and 20-day averages, indicating near-term consolidation. Technical indicators presented a mixed picture, with bullish MACD and moving averages offset by bearish monthly RSI and KST signals, suggesting cautious optimism.

19 June: Outperformance Amid Sensex Decline Closes Week

In the final trading session of the week, BSE Ltd rebounded with a 0.14% gain to close at Rs.4,020.20, outperforming the Sensex which declined 0.30%. The stock recorded a traded volume of 5,31,195 shares and a traded value of ₹2,13,67.74 lakhs, maintaining strong liquidity and institutional interest. Despite a slight 5.47% dip in delivery volumes, the stock’s technical positioning remained robust above medium- and long-term moving averages. The Mojo Grade Strong Buy rating and a Mojo Score of 82.0 underpin the stock’s favourable fundamental and technical outlook as it closed the week just below its opening price.

Key Takeaways from the Week

Robust Institutional Interest: Throughout the week, BSE Ltd attracted strong institutional participation, evidenced by high traded volumes and significant delivery volume surges, particularly on 15 and 18 June. This sustained interest underscores confidence in the company’s fundamentals and market position.

Technical Strength with Mixed Signals: The stock consistently traded above its medium- and long-term moving averages, signalling a bullish trend. However, mixed technical indicators such as bearish monthly RSI and KST suggest caution, indicating potential short-term consolidation or volatility.

Mojo Grade Upgrade Reinforces Confidence: The upgrade to a Strong Buy rating with a Mojo Score of 82.0 reflects improved fundamentals and technical momentum, supporting the stock’s appeal as a mid-cap leader in the capital markets sector.

Price Volatility and Consolidation: Despite early-week gains, the stock experienced a sharp dip on 17 June (-3.92%) and subsequent consolidation near Rs.4,000. This price action highlights short-term profit-taking and market volatility amid broader sector and macroeconomic factors.

Underperformance vs Sensex: While the Sensex gained 2.35% over the week, BSE Ltd declined 0.52%, indicating relative underperformance. Investors should monitor whether the stock can regain momentum and align with broader market gains in coming weeks.

Conclusion: A Week of Strong Interest Amid Price Consolidation

BSE Ltd’s week was characterised by strong institutional interest and robust trading volumes, supported by an upgraded Mojo Grade and positive technical positioning above key moving averages. However, the stock faced short-term price volatility and ended the week slightly lower, underperforming the Sensex’s gains. Mixed technical signals suggest a cautious outlook in the near term, with potential for consolidation before any sustained upward move. Investors should continue to monitor delivery volumes, technical indicators, and sector trends to assess the stock’s trajectory within the capital markets space.
